2005 Rhode Island Code - § 2-1-19 — Public policy on swamps, marshes, and fresh water wetlands.
It is the public policy of the state to preserve the purity and integrity of
the swamps, marshes, and other fresh water wetlands of this state. The health,
welfare, and general well being of the populace and the protection of life and
property require that the state restrict the uses of wetlands and, in the
exercise of the police power those wetlands are to be regulated hereunder.
